Anthropic's Mythos AI autonomously exploits software vulnerabilities, j financial sector

Anthropic has released Mythos, an AI system capable of autonomously finding and exploiting software vulnerabilities, including decades-old flaws in the hardened OpenBSD operating system. The system has triggered a high-level government response in India, where Finance Minister Sitharaman convened top banks and established a panel led SBI chairman to assess risks. Fintech players including Paytm, Razorpay, and Pine Labs have reportedly approached Anthropic to use Mythos for their own testing.

This event exemplifies the pattern where frontier-model capabilities are repurposed from defensive to offensive postures, creating a dual-use dilemma that reverberates across regulation and market structure. For India's financial stack — built on interconnected digital rails like UPI, Aadhaar-linked auth, and cloud-native banking APIs — the threat model shifts from human-speed to machine-speed attacks to machine-speed exploitation. The government's response signals that AI-driven cybersecurity is transitioning from a compliance checkbox to a national economic security issue.

Industry analyst skeptical of readiness, noting that many banks still rely on manual triage and fragmented asset visibility. The implications are segment-level: Mythos could accelerate adoption of AI-native security tools while pressuring legacy financial institutions to modernize their vulnerability management. The fintech soft underbelly — smaller platforms with deep API integration into larger banking networks — becomes an attack surface that will likely drive consolidation or stricter regulatory requirements for embedded finance players.
